Output 58fe94b1690ce36b89d4aa214d7cbc1a1bf5464d68b563e627335922e37aa568:7

value
278001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571bb589d3948fd663b434efbb0b1b8199b1315e OP_EQUAL
address
39dbuVoXHLQr1KA62rQDdpdiJgVs9Ngwwf
transaction
58fe94b1690ce36b89d4aa214d7cbc1a1bf5464d68b563e627335922e37aa568
spent
true